What are security automation solutions?

Security automation solutions are tools and processes designed to automate tasks related to the detection, analysis, and response to digital threats.

These solutions allow certain actions to be executed automatically, without constant human intervention, significantly improving operational efficiency.

They include functionalities such as:

  • Automatic threat detection
  • Automated incident response
  • Continuous analysis of security events
  • Integration between different systems
  • Security process orchestration

How security automation solutions work?

Security automation solutions operate by integrating different security systems and executing actions based on predefined rules.

Data collection

Events are captured from multiple sources such as networks, systems, and applications.

Automatic analysis

Systems analyze events to identify patterns or suspicious behavior.

Action execution

When a threat is detected, actions are executed such as:

  • Blocking access
  • Isolating devices
  • Generating alerts
  • Activating security protocols

     

Systems continuously learn and improve their detection capabilities.

Common mistakes when implementing security automation

Not defining clear processes

Automating without a strategy can create more problems.

Lack of integration

Isolated systems reduce effectiveness.

Over-automation

Not everything should be automated; balance is required.

Not monitoring automation

It is necessary to supervise that processes function correctly.
